+/*
+ * m_functions execute protocol messages on this server:
+ *
+ * cptr is always NON-NULL, pointing to a *LOCAL* client
+ * structure (with an open socket connected!). This
+ * identifies the physical socket where the message
+ * originated (or which caused the m_function to be
+ * executed--some m_functions may call others...).
+ *
+ * sptr is the source of the message, defined by the
+ * prefix part of the message if present. If not
+ * or prefix not found, then sptr==cptr.
+ *
+ * (!IsServer(cptr)) => (cptr == sptr), because
+ * prefixes are taken *only* from servers...
+ *
+ * (IsServer(cptr))
+ * (sptr == cptr) => the message didn't
+ * have the prefix.
+ *
+ * (sptr != cptr && IsServer(sptr) means
+ * the prefix specified servername. (?)
+ *
+ * (sptr != cptr && !IsServer(sptr) means
+ * that message originated from a remote
+ * user (not local).
+ *
+ * combining
+ *
+ * (!IsServer(sptr)) means that, sptr can safely
+ * taken as defining the target structure of the
+ * message in this server.
+ *
+ * *Always* true (if 'parse' and others are working correct):
+ *
+ * 1) sptr->from == cptr (note: cptr->from == cptr)
+ *
+ * 2) MyConnect(sptr) <=> sptr == cptr (e.g. sptr
+ * *cannot* be a local connection, unless it's
+ * actually cptr!). [MyConnect(x) should probably
+ * be defined as (x == x->from) --msa ]
+ *
+ * parc number of variable parameter strings (if zero,
+ * parv is allowed to be NULL)
+ *
+ * parv a NULL terminated list of parameter pointers,
+ *
+ * parv[0], sender (prefix string), if not present
+ * this points to an empty string.
+ * parv[1]...parv[parc-1]
+ * pointers to additional parameters
+ * parv[parc] == NULL, *always*
+ *
+ * note: it is guaranteed that parv[0]..parv[parc-1] are all
+ * non-NULL pointers.
+ */

+/*
+ * ms_account - server message handler
+ *
+ * parv[0] = sender prefix
+ * parv[1] = numeric of client to act on
+ * parv[2] = account name (12 characters or less)
+ */
+int ms_account(struct Client* cptr, struct Client* sptr, int parc,
+ char* parv[])
+{
+ struct Client *acptr;
+
+ if (parc < 3)
+ return need_more_params(sptr, "ACCOUNT");
+
+ if (!IsServer(sptr))
+ return protocol_violation(cptr, "ACCOUNT from non-server %s",
+ cli_name(sptr));
+
+ if (!(acptr = findNUser(parv[1])))
+ return 0; /* Ignore ACCOUNT for a user that QUIT; probably crossed */
+
+ if (IsAccount(acptr))
+ return protocol_violation(cptr, "ACCOUNT for already registered user %s "
+ "(%s -> %s)", cli_name(acptr),
+ cli_user(acptr)->account, parv[2]);
+
+ assert(0 == cli_user(acptr)->account[0]);
+
+ if (strlen(parv[2]) > ACCOUNTLEN)
+ return protocol_violation(cptr,
+ "Received account (%s) longer than %d for %s; "
+ "ignoring.",
+ parv[2], ACCOUNTLEN, cli_name(acptr));
+
+ if (parc > 3) {
+ cli_user(acptr)->acc_create = atoi(parv[3]);
+ Debug((DEBUG_DEBUG, "Received timestamped account: account \"%s\", "
+ "timestamp %Tu", parv[2], cli_user(acptr)->acc_create));
+ }
+
+ ircd_strncpy(cli_user(acptr)->account, parv[2], ACCOUNTLEN);
+ hide_hostmask(acptr, FLAG_ACCOUNT);
+
+ sendcmdto_serv_butone(sptr, CMD_ACCOUNT, cptr,
+ cli_user(acptr)->acc_create ? "%C %s %Tu" : "%C %s",
+ acptr, cli_user(acptr)->account,
+ cli_user(acptr)->acc_create);
+
+ return 0;
+}
